CFL Scores Today: Edmonton Elks 23, Calgary Stampeders 18 - Elks Secure Road Victory in Alberta Rivalry

Highlights:

• Justin Rankin rushes for 140 yards on 10 carries for Edmonton
• Tre Ford throws for 208 yards and a touchdown for the Elks
• Calgary's Matthew Shiltz passes for 215 yards and a score in losing effort

Game Recap:

The Edmonton Elks (6-11) pulled off a 23-18 road victory over their provincial rivals, the Calgary Stampeders (4-11), in a hard-fought Week 18 matchup. The win keeps Edmonton's slim playoff hopes alive while dealing another blow to Calgary's postseason aspirations.

Edmonton Elks Performance:

The Elks' offense was firing on all cylinders, with quarterback Tre Ford efficiently managing the game and running back Justin Rankin providing a spark on the ground. The defense came up with timely stops and turnovers to secure the victory.

Top Offensive Players:
• Tre Ford: QB - 23/29, 208 yards, 1 TD, 2 INT
• Justin Rankin: RB - 10 carries, 140 yards
• Eugene Lewis: WR - 6 receptions, 46 yards, 1 TD, 1 rush TD
• Tevin Jones: WR - 6 receptions, 76 yards
• Dakota Prukop: QB - 2 carries, 3 yards, 1 TD

Top Defensive Players:
• Nick Anderson: LB - 7 tackles, 1 sack
• Derrick Moncrief: LB - 6 tackles, 2 sacks
• Darrius Bratton: DB - 4 tackles
• Elliott Brown: DL - 2 tackles, 1 sack
• Shawn Oakman: DL - 1 tackle, 1 interception

Calgary Stampeders Performance:

The Stampeders struggled to find consistency on offense, despite a solid effort from quarterback Matthew Shiltz. Their defense kept them in the game, but ultimately couldn't overcome Edmonton's balanced attack.

Top Offensive Players:
• Matthew Shiltz: QB - 18/33, 215 yards, 1 TD, 1 INT
• Reggie Begelton: WR - 5 receptions, 79 yards
• Dedrick Mills: RB - 7 carries, 36 yards
• Jalen Philpot: WR - 4 receptions, 28 yards, 1 TD
• Tommy Stevens: QB - 3 carries, 9 yards, 1 TD

Top Defensive Players:
• Tyler Richardson: LB - 7 tackles
• Benjamin Labrosse: DB - 6 tackles
• Micah Awe: LB - 4 tackles
• Cameron Judge: LB - 4 tackles
• Bentlee Sanders: DB - 4 tackles

The CFL standings continue to take shape as we approach the end of the regular season. In the West Division, the Winnipeg Blue Bombers (10-7) maintain their lead, followed by the Saskatchewan Roughriders (8-7) and BC Lions (8-8). The East Division is led by the Montreal Alouettes (11-3), with the Toronto Argonauts (9-7) and Ottawa Redblacks (8-6) in pursuit.
